Two solicitors face disciplinary action over work on an allegedly fraudulent quick sale property scheme.
Wolverhampton-based Kumari-Banga Solicitors service to homeowners has been investigated by the Solicitors Regulation Authority (SRA).
Twelve of their clients have been compensated after they sold homes through speedyproperty.co.uk, including one seller in Flintshire.
A representative for the two solicitors said they did not wish to comment.
Partners Meena Kumari and Teena Kumari Banga are facing a hearing of the Solicitors Disciplinary Tribunal (SDT) over allegations they acted in conveyancing transactions they either knew, or should have known, were fraudulent.
